Specifications

Chemical Name or Material Agarose
Name Note Low-Melting, <1kb DNA/RNA
Physical Form Powder/Solid
CAS 9012-36-6
Color Cream
Quantity 100 g
DNase DNase free
Electroendosmosis (EEO) 0.15 max.
Gelation Temperature 35°C max.
Gel Strength 500g/cm2min.
Packaging Poly Bottle
Purity Grade Notes DNase- and RNase-Free
Molecular Formula C12H18O9
Formula Weight 306.12
Grade Genetic Analysis
